Type Analysis

The rubber granules market is segmented by type into synthetic rubber granules and natural rubber granules, each catering to distinct application requirements and end-user preferences. Synthetic rubber granules, derived primarily from recycled tires and industrial rubber waste, dominate the market with approximately 72.5% share in 2025, due to their cost-effectiveness, consistent quality, and widespread availability. These granules exhibit excellent resistance to abrasion, weathering, and chemical exposure, making them ideal for demanding applications such as sports surfaces, automotive components, and industrial flooring. The ability to customize the properties of synthetic rubber granules through compounding and additives further enhances their appeal across various industries. The use of EPDM rubber as a base feedstock for premium synthetic granule grades is growing, given its excellent UV and weather resistance characteristics.

Rubber Granules Market Share by Type 2025

Natural rubber granules, sourced from the processing of natural rubber latex, are gaining traction in applications where superior elasticity, biodegradability, and low toxicity are prioritized. Although natural rubber granules represent approximately 27.5% of the market in 2025, their use is expanding in premium sports surfaces, playgrounds, and environmentally sensitive projects. The renewable nature of natural rubber and its lower environmental footprint are key factors driving its adoption, particularly in regions with abundant rubber plantations and supportive government policies. Developments in the broader natural rubber industry are directly influencing the availability, pricing, and quality of feedstock for granule producers. However, the higher cost and limited availability of natural rubber granules in non-producing regions pose challenges to their widespread adoption.

The competition between synthetic and natural rubber granules is intensifying as end-users become more discerning about product performance and sustainability credentials. Manufacturers are increasingly focusing on developing hybrid solutions that blend the advantages of both types, offering enhanced durability, safety, and environmental compatibility. The ongoing research into bio-based rubber alternatives and advanced processing techniques is expected to blur the lines between synthetic and natural rubber granules, paving the way for innovative product offerings that cater to evolving market demands through 2034.

Market dynamics within the type segment are also influenced by regional factors such as raw material availability, regulatory standards, and consumer preferences. Asia Pacific, being a major producer of natural rubber, has a competitive edge in the production and consumption of natural rubber granules. In contrast, North America and Europe rely more on synthetic rubber granules due to their well-established tire recycling infrastructure and advanced processing capabilities. The interplay between supply chain dynamics, pricing trends, and technological advancements will continue to shape the competitive landscape of the rubber granules market by type throughout the forecast period.

Application Analysis

The application segment of the rubber granules market encompasses sports surfaces, playground flooring, automotive, construction, industrial, and others, reflecting the versatility and adaptability of rubber granules across diverse end-use scenarios. Sports surfaces represent the largest application segment in 2025, driven by the increasing construction of stadiums, athletic tracks, and synthetic turf fields worldwide. Rubber granules are preferred for their shock-absorbing properties, slip resistance, and ability to withstand heavy foot traffic, ensuring athlete safety and performance. The growing popularity of multi-purpose sports facilities and community playgrounds is further boosting demand in this segment.

Playground flooring is another significant application area, where rubber granules are used to create impact-absorbing surfaces that minimize injury risks for children. The emphasis on child safety, compliance with international safety standards, and the need for low-maintenance, weather-resistant materials are key factors driving the adoption of rubber granules in playgrounds. Innovations in color, texture, and design are enabling manufacturers to offer aesthetically pleasing and functional flooring solutions that cater to the unique requirements of schools, parks, and recreational centers.

In the automotive sector, rubber granules find application in sound insulation, anti-vibration pads, and underbody coatings, contributing to vehicle comfort, durability, and noise reduction. The shift towards lightweight, sustainable materials in automotive manufacturing is creating new opportunities for rubber granules, particularly as automakers seek to enhance fuel efficiency and reduce their environmental impact. The construction industry is also a major consumer of rubber granules in 2025, utilizing them in flooring, roofing, and insulation products that offer enhanced durability, thermal performance, and sustainability. The use of specialized rubber lining applications in industrial construction is an adjacent area that is increasingly crossing over with granule-based products.

Industrial applications of rubber granules include the production of mats, gaskets, conveyor belts, and other components that require resilience, flexibility, and resistance to harsh operating conditions. The adaptability of rubber granules to various processing techniques, such as molding, extrusion, and compounding, is enabling manufacturers to cater to a wide range of industrial requirements. The "others" category encompasses emerging applications such as landscaping, animal bedding, and molded goods, reflecting the continuous expansion of the rubber granules market into new domains through the 2026-2034 period.

Opportunities & Threats

The rubber granules market presents abundant opportunities for growth, particularly in the realm of sustainable development and circular economy initiatives. The increasing emphasis on recycling end-of-life tires and rubber products is creating a steady supply of raw materials for granule production, while also addressing environmental concerns associated with landfill waste. Technological advancements in recycling processes, such as devulcanization, cryogenic grinding, and surface modification, are enabling manufacturers to produce high-quality granules with enhanced performance characteristics. Innovations in rubber regeneration chemistry, including the development of new rubber regeneration activator formulations, are improving the processability and end-product quality of recycled granules. The growing demand for eco-friendly construction materials, coupled with regulatory incentives and green building certifications, is opening up new avenues for rubber granules in the construction and infrastructure sectors.

Another significant opportunity lies in product innovation and diversification. Manufacturers are investing in research and development to create value-added rubber granule products that cater to specific end-user requirements, such as colored granules for aesthetic applications, antimicrobial granules for healthcare settings, and high-performance granules for industrial uses. The integration of digital technologies, such as IoT-enabled smart surfaces and data analytics for performance monitoring, is enabling companies to offer differentiated solutions and enhance customer value. Strategic collaborations, mergers and acquisitions, and partnerships with research institutions are also facilitating knowledge sharing, technology transfer, and market expansion. The emergence of online retail and e-commerce platforms is providing manufacturers with new channels to reach customers, streamline distribution, and improve market visibility through 2034.

Despite the favorable growth outlook, the rubber granules market faces certain restraining factors. One of the primary challenges is the volatility in raw material prices, particularly for synthetic rubber derived from petroleum-based feedstocks. Fluctuations in crude oil prices, supply chain disruptions, and geopolitical uncertainties can impact the cost structure and profitability of rubber granule manufacturers. Additionally, the presence of stringent regulations regarding the use of recycled materials, quality standards, and environmental compliance can pose barriers to market entry and expansion. Concerns regarding the potential health and environmental impacts of certain additives and chemicals used in rubber granule production may also affect consumer perception and regulatory approvals. Addressing these challenges will require proactive risk management, investment in sustainable sourcing, and continuous innovation to ensure compliance and maintain market competitiveness.

Regional Outlook

The Asia Pacific region dominated the rubber granules market in 2025, accounting for approximately 38% of the global market share, with a market size of approximately USD 874 million. This dominance can be attributed to rapid industrialization, urban infrastructure development, and a strong focus on recycling initiatives in countries such as China, India, Japan, and Southeast Asian nations. The region's abundant availability of raw materials, large population base, and increasing investments in sports infrastructure and construction projects are driving demand for rubber granules. Government policies promoting sustainable development, coupled with rising awareness about the benefits of recycled materials, are further supporting market growth in Asia Pacific. The region is expected to maintain a steady CAGR of 6.2% during the forecast period, outpacing other regions in terms of growth rate and market expansion through 2034.

Rubber Granules Market Regional Share 2025

North America is the second-largest regional market, with a market size of approximately USD 621 million in 2025, accounting for around 27% of the global share. The mature recycling industry, stringent environmental regulations, and high consumer awareness regarding sustainability are key factors driving market growth in this region. The United States and Canada are leading contributors, with extensive investments in sports facilities, playgrounds, and green building projects. The presence of established manufacturers, advanced recycling technologies, and a strong distribution network are enabling North America to maintain its competitive edge. The region is projected to witness a moderate CAGR of 4.8% over the forecast period, with steady demand from the sports, automotive, and construction sectors.

Europe holds a significant share of the global rubber granules market, valued at approximately USD 506 million in 2025, representing approximately 22% of the total market. The region's commitment to sustainability, circular economy principles, and stringent waste management regulations are driving the adoption of recycled rubber granules across various applications. Countries such as Germany, France, the United Kingdom, and Italy are at the forefront of market growth, supported by robust recycling infrastructure and government incentives for green construction. The Middle East & Africa and Latin America are emerging markets, with a combined market size of approximately USD 299 million in 2025, driven by increasing investments in infrastructure, sports facilities, and urban development projects. These regions offer significant growth potential, particularly as governments and private sector players focus on sustainable development and environmental conservation through the 2026-2034 forecast window.

The COVID-19 pandemic had a moderately adverse impact on the rubber granules market during 2019-2020. Disruptions to sports facility construction, automotive production shutdowns, and reduced infrastructure spending temporarily slowed demand. Supply chain bottlenecks and labor shortages affected recycling operations and raw material availability. However, the market demonstrated resilience due to its essential role in sustainable waste management, and recovery was swift from 2021 onward, supported by resumed sports infrastructure projects and stimulus-driven construction activity.
